Shweta Tiwari is hailed as television's favourite bahu, thanks to her acting stint as Prerna in Kasautii Zindagii Kay. While she has seen tremendous success in her career, her personal life wasn't a bed of roses. She had faced domestic violence in her marriage with Raja Chaudhary and then the same incident happened in her second marriage with Abhinav Kohli. Despite it all, one person that stood with her in the difficult and happy times was her daughter (from first marriage), Palak Tiwari. The mother-daughter duo keeps on sharing their love for each other and snippets from their life on their Instagram feeds. 

On February 6, 2020, Shweta took to her Instagram handle and posted a picture with Palak. And we cannot ignore the uncanny resemblance that the mother-daughter duo shared. Shweta and Palak were dressed in matching black t-shirts. Along with the picture, the actress wrote, "Nothing but Sandy Skin and Summer Smiles! #etherealgirl @palaktiwarii". Shweta shares a beautiful bond with her daughter. In an interaction with the Hindustan Times, Shweta had shared that it was her family, who made her strong in the times of need. After all, she is a parent and she is the one, who has to raise her daughter (Palak) and son (Reyansh).
